Pours amber in color with a decent amount of fluffy white head, not much lacing.

The scent is of piney hops and sugar.

The taste was very sweet at first, there was some light piney hop presence, alcohol was also noticeable.

Light bodied, crisp and refreshing, highly carbonated.

This wasn't very complex in the flavor department but it was very good and refreshing. It's very easy to drink a bunch of these.

The beer pours a dark golden/amber color with a thin offwhite head that fades to spotty lacing. The aroma is decent. It has a good malty scent that boasts of pale and light crystal malts along with fresh hop aroma; quite nice. The taste is decent as well. It has a smooth malty flavor that melds well with the lovely fresh hop taste. It was wet hopped with hops from the brewers home hop garden. They are quite fresh tasting. The mouthfeel was pretty bad however. I was told there was a carbonation issue with this beer. There was little to no carbonation to it, which made drinking it not very enjoyable. This was a good IPA. I wish it was carbonated so I could enjoy the aroma and taste more.

A - Pours 1 1/2 fingers of white head that has an ok retention and leaves some spotty lacing. The beer itself is clear and amber in color.

S - Has a slightly sweet caramel aroma followed by piny hops, but pretty tame in the aroma department.

M - A light-medium bodied beer. It has a creamier feel due to the low amount of carbonation.

T - A lot like it smells. The caramel malt up front followed by the piney hops. It's slightly bitter on the finish. It's good, but not extraordinary.

Overall a decent brew. It has a pretty good flavor, and is pretty low in alcohol for an IPA, which makes it very drinkable.
